What is the difference between Intern Project Accountant vs Project Accountant?
| Aspect | Intern Project Accountant | Project Accountant |
|---|---|---|
| Required Credentials | Enrolled in or recent graduate of accounting/finance program | Bachelor's degree in accounting, finance, or related field; CPA preferred |
| Work Environment | Internship setting, learning-focused, entry-level | Full-time, professional environment, responsible for project financials |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Used in construction, engineering, and consulting firms for training | Common in similar industries for managing project budgets and costs |
The Intern Project Accountant role is an entry-level position designed for students or recent graduates gaining industry experience. In contrast, the Project Accountant is a full-time professional responsible for managing project finances, budgets, and reporting. Both roles are common in industries like construction and engineering, but the intern position focuses on learning and support, while the project accountant handles core financial tasks.

The internship program provides an introduction to audit. As an intern in Deloitte's Audit & Assurance practice, you'll experience the auditing profession from a real-world perspective. You'll get in-depth exposure to the auditing profession and learn more about the day-to-day responsibilities of an auditor. You'll receive guidance and work closely with experienced audit professionals, as well as have the opportunity to participate in networking activities. You'll have exposure to issues shaping and affecting the profession today as well as topics related to your own career development. Your coach will serve as a vital source of information and advice, offering timely, constructive feedback on your performance.
Recruiting for this role ends on September 23, 2026.
Work You'll Do
During your internship, you'll sharpen your analytical skills as you audit client financials, transactions and internal control processes. You'll work with audit team members and learn how to apply concepts of risk assessment and how to design and perform audit procedures responsive to those risks. You will execute these audit procedures using our cutting-edge audit tools and technologies that use artificial intelligence, advanced analytics, data visualizations and process flow automation to perform data interrogation and analysis of client data.
You'll have the opportunity to work across our Audit and Assurance offerings - including Audit, Specialized Assurance, Accounting & Reporting, Controls, and Internal Audit - bringing together diverse skills, leading-edge technology, and a global network to deliver high-quality audits, assurance reports, and insights that shape how organizations report and operate. You will build adaptable, transferable skillsets that are critical for future leaders as the profession evolves.
As a Financial Statement Audit intern, you may:
- Work alongside experienced audit professionals to deliver high-quality financial statement audits for leading clients across a variety of industries
- Develop a strong foundation in accounting, auditing, risk assessment, and professional judgment through real client work and structured learning
- Gain hands-on experience performing audit procedures over key financial statement accounts, transactions, and disclosures
- Help evaluate the design and operating effectiveness of internal controls related to financial reporting
- Analyze financial information and supporting documentation to identify risks, trends, and potential issues
- Prepare clear, accurate, and well-organized audit documentation in line with professional standards and firm methodology
- Collaborate directly with client personnel and engagement teams to gather information, resolve questions, and support audit execution
- Use innovative tools, data analytics, and emerging technologies to enhance audit quality and efficiency
